I'm looking to pick up a bear tag for second or third season because I have seen big tracks and a lot of sign where I hunt this year. Does anyone have suggestions on which season to pick it up for? I am getting one of those tags that are only available if you have a deer or elk tag.

I posted this in the predator forum as well but nobody was home.
 
I have not but I am picking up a tag as well. I have seen six this week alone so I figure I might as well give it a go.
 
Third season may be a bit late for a bear tag. It could be better hunting for deer and elk though.

Toss up,

Beanman
 
They start winding down by 1st rifle elk. If you did run into a bear after that time it would probably be a older boar. I have never seen a bear after that 2nd week of October. Good luck !
 
Ok I definitely wont pick up the tag for third season then. Thanks for the info.
